openclaw-ambassador scanned grade B with 2 findings against 26 rules in 11 categories — prompt injection, anti-refusal, data exfiltration, privilege escalation, supply chain, agent snooping, system-prompt leakage, SSRF and excessive agency — measured 7d ago.

A static scan of the body, not an audit. Every finding is printed with the line that produced it so you can judge whether it matters here. A mod is markdown that instructs an agent; that is exactly why what it instructs is worth reading.

Downloads and executes remote codemediumSupply chain

curl | sh runs whatever the server returns today, which is not necessarily what it returned when this was reviewed.
